As far as I know, these are the correct descriptions of MS: S and EoL:

MasterSword: Source is MasterSword on the Source engine. MasterSword: Source will follow the original layout of the MasterSword world (read: the continent of Daragoth) based on the story "Lanethan" by Lanethan. This means custom maps such as the Curse of the Bear Gods, World Walker One, the Frozen Summit, the Forgotten Outpost, the Badlands and so on will not be a part of the world.

Era of Legends is basically MasterSword 2 (and also on the Source engine). Era of Legends takes place 400 years (not 200, but 400, Gurluas) after MasterSword. The Orcs have overrun the continent of Daragoth, so all the humans, dwarves and elves have fled to the continent of Valen (read it here: http://eol.fragism.com/history.html).

Also, about the thing with huge maps: the Source map limit is 4 times bigger in X, Y and Z directions than the Goldsource map limit. This means the horizontal plane (XY) is 16 times bigger (4 times 4). The total volume of a Source map (XYZ) is 64 times bigger (4 times 4 times 4).
area_hl1_vs_hl2.gif


The Goldsource anime-fighting mod Earth's Special Forces, based on the Dragonball Z anime series, scaled all the player models down. This gives the impression you are walking/flying around in huge maps. The maps are actually just as big as any other Goldsource map you've ever played. They only appear to be big because you're about 1/4th as tall as you would be in most other mods.
ESF Forums 'THE BIG MEGA THREAD OF MAPPING.' said:
Remember that all Earth`s Special Forces player models are 1/4 the size of a Half-Life player model.

I haven't played the Empires mod yet, but I assume they did the same thing. Making the maximum map size larger would require alot of difficult coding, but using downscaled models would be much easier when you're making a new mod.

Yeah, interesting thing about Empires....Squirrel and I were playing around and we set noclip mode on ourselves and flew up (while facing the map). There are a infinite amount of the same map (And they are different than the one you play on, because none of the structs were built) which is odd.

But we did find that the outside ring around the playable map is actually tiny (You look like Godzilla to it) and hidden under the map (it uses a camera to project on "screens" which makes it look right). Kinda pointless to know, unless you like standing by the camera and waiting for a noob to come in, "OMFG HOWD U GET SO BIG LAWL"
